K1x Release - 02/25/2026
Check out the following changes that have been introduced as part of this K1x release.
990 Tracker
Features
-
State E-file Validation: With this release state e-filing has been updated so that state returns that require inclusion of a validated federal return may no longer be selected for submission without also selecting the federal return.
Bug Fixes
- Attachments (2022 and 2023): An issue with the ability to add attachments under Review and File Forms, has been addressed.
- Form 990, 990PF, 990-T: The telephone number for the organization will now display a leading zero for foreign numbers, when applicable.
- Form 990 Part V and VI - E-file Validation: An issue that resulted in e-file validation failure when an integer value of 0 was entered for any of Part V, Lines 1a, 1b, or 1c or Part VI Lines 1a or 1c, has been addressed.
- Form 990 Part I and III: An issue with text wrapping for the following areas of Form 990: Part I, Line 1, Part III, Line 1 and Part III, Lines 4a through 4d, has been addressed.
- Form 990-EZ Parts I and II: An issue with 0 values failing to display on the PDF has been addressed.
- Form 990-W: An issue with overpayment from Form 990-T not carrying to Form 990-W Line 13, when applicable, has been addressed.
- Digital Signature: An issue with dignital signature failing to display on Form 990, 990-T and 990-PF, has been addressed.
- California Form 199, Part II, Line 18 (2024): An issue with total expenses, line 18, not including amounts entered for Line 9, has been resolved.
- Missouri Form MO-1120: An issue with the mark box for discuss with paid preparer failing to be reflected on the PDF, has been addressed.
